Dipika wins, Joshna loses
CHENNAI: Putting aside the disappointment of having had to drop out of the competition in the New Delhi Commonwealth Games because of illness, India's Dipika Pallikal made a strong start with a fighting win over Ireland's Aisling Blake in a first round match of the Qatar Classic squash being held in Doha.
The unseeded Indian won in five games 13-11, 3-11, 4-11, 11-4, 12-10 that went to 64 minutes.
Another Indian, Joshna Chinappa battled it out against New Zealand's Jaclyn Hawkes but lost the grip in the final game.
The New Zealander won the 47-minute tussle 11-5, 4-11, 11-4, 9-11, 11-8.
